Essential Ingredients for the Perfect Chicken
- 4 Chicken Breasts
- 1 Cup Italian Dressing
- 1/2 Cup Mayonnaise
- 1 Teaspoon Garlic Powder
- 1 Teaspoon Dried Italian Herbs (oregano, basil, etc.)
- 1 Cup Grated Parmesan Cheese
- Salt and Pepper to Taste

Easy Cooking Directions
- Preheat Your Oven: Start by preheating your oven to 375°F (190°C) to prepare for that beautiful, baked chicken.
- Prepare the Marinade: In a medium bowl, mix together the Italian dressing, mayonnaise, garlic powder, and dried herbs. Go ahead and take a moment to enjoy that fragrant blend!
- Season the Chicken: Take your chicken breasts and place them in a greased baking dish. Season them with salt and pepper, giving them a nice flavor foundation.
- Coat the Chicken: Pour the delicious marinade over the chicken, ensuring each piece is generously coated. It’s okay if some excess pools at the bottom—it flavors the chicken perfectly while it cooks!
- Bake to Perfection: Place the baking dish in your preheated oven and bake for 25-30 minutes, or until the chicken is cooked through with an internal temperature of 165°F (75°C).
- Add the Cheese: In the last 5 minutes of baking, sprinkle the grated Parmesan cheese atop the chicken. This will create a delightful, melty topping that brings everything together.
- Serve and Enjoy: Once it’s out of the oven, serve hot, and watch everyone gather around to dig in and savor this tasty Italian Dressing Chicken!
Pro Pointers for Best Results
- Don’t Overcook: Keep an eye on your chicken to avoid dryness. A meat thermometer can be your best friend here!
- Marination Time: If time allows, marinating the chicken for an hour or even overnight can enhance the flavor significantly.
- Cheese Variations: Swap out Parmesan for mozzarella for a gooey experience, or add a dash of smoked cheese for a unique twist.
- Flavor Boosters: A squeeze of lemon juice before serving can brighten the flavors wonderfully.

Make Ahead & Storage Tips
Prep the chicken and marinate it up to a day in advance, allowing the rich flavors to develop. Store any leftovers in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 4 days. For freezing, place the cooked chicken in an airtight container, and it will last for up to 3 months. To reheat, gently warm the chicken in the oven at a low temperature to maintain its moisture.

Common Queries
What’s the best cooking method for this chicken? Baking is ideal for keeping the chicken juicy and flavorful. You can also grill or pan-sear if you prefer those methods!
Can I use chicken thighs instead of breasts? Absolutely! Thighs are naturally more forgiving and are perfect for this recipe.
How can I add extra vegetables? Consider adding halved baby potatoes, broccoli, or bell peppers to the baking dish for a complete meal in one pan.
Is it necessary to marinate the chicken? While optional, marinating enhances the flavor, making the dish extra delicious.
What if I don’t have Italian dressing? You can make a quick marinade with olive oil, vinegar, and Italian herbs as a substitute.
Can I make this in advance? Yes, you can marinate and store the chicken in the fridge for a few hours or overnight for better flavor.
